Caustic and Analytical Illuminance Calculations for a Model of the Human Eye

Abstract
The analytical flux monitoring technique has been used to evaluate the caustic surface and line spread function (energy flux distribution along a line) on different image planes for point source light passing through a model of the human eye. It is shown by comparison with the standard spot diagrams that the caustic is a valuable tool in evaluating the aberra-tions and performance of the model of the human eye.
